Pentax K200D Digital camera overview

The K200D offers 10.2 megapixel resolution with the sophisticated PRIME (PENTAX Real Image Engine) and PENTAX-developed Shake Reduction (SR) system, a 2.7-inch LCD Monitor, a user-friendly Dust Removal system including the new Dust Alert feature, 11-point SAFOX VIII auto focus system, sophisticated 16-segment multi-pattern metering and auto sensitivity control up to ISO 1600, Custom Image functions and Expanded Dynamic Range function. All this and more in a weather and dust resistant body.

Pentax K200D Digital camera features

  High quality image reproduction

The K200D combines a large, high-performance 23.5mm x 15.7mm CCD image sensor with the sophisticated PRIME (PENTAX Real IMage Engine) as its imaging engine. With its approximately 10.2 effective megapixel resolution, the K200D produces beautiful, fine-detailed images with subtle gradations and texture descriptions. The K200D also features a Custom Image function which lets the user select one of six finishing touches to reflect his or her creative intentions with great ease with the ability to further fine tune them.

PENTAX-original SR (Shake Reduction) mechanism

The PENTAX-developed SR (Shake Reduction) mechanism effectively reduces camera shake for sharp, blur-free images even under demanding shooting conditions and is compatible with almost all existing PENTAX interchangeable lenses.* . It offers an outstanding compensation effect, equivalent to approximately 2.5 to 4 shutter-speed steps.
*Lenses compatible with this mechanism are: the PENTAX K-, KA-, KAF- and KAF2-mount lenses, screw-mount lenses (with an adapter); and 645- and 67-system lenses (with an adapter). Some functions may not be applicable with certain lenses.

Comprehensive Dust Removal system

The K200D features the user-friendly Dust Removal (DR) system to prevent dust from sticking to the surface of the CCD image sensor (or low-pass filter). This DR system offers a new Dust Alert function, which allows the user to check for dust on the image sensor in advance, helping to reduce the need for time-consuming retouching later on.

Dust-proof, water-resistant construction

The K200D boasts an extremely reliable dust-proof, water-resistant construction, with special seals applied to 60 different parts of the camera body, including the shutter release button and switches/levers/dials. This dependable body makes it possible to use the K200D in the rain or dusty locations without worries.

Auto sensitivity control up to ISO 1600

The auto sensitivity control function automatically sets the optimum sensitivity up to ISO 1600, based on such data as the subject’s brightness level and the lens’ focal length. This function allows the user to use faster shutter speeds in poor lighting situations, helping to effectively reduce camera shake and prevent blurred images. For specialized applications, the sensitivity can be set manually from ISO 100 to ISO 1600 in increments of 1, 1/2 or 1/3 EV using custom functions.

High-precision 11-point wide-frame AF

The K200D’s advanced SAFOX VIII autofocus system features 11 sensor points (with nine cross-type sensors positioned in the middle) to automatically focus on the subject with utmost precision, regardless of where they are in the frame. Choice of 16-segment multi-pattern metering, center-weighted metering and spot metering accommodates various photographic applications.

Bright, clear viewfinder

Combining a lightweight penta-mirror prism with PENTAX-original finder optics and the acclaimed Natural-Bright-Matte II focusing screen, the K200D’s viewfinder delivers a large, bright image with an approximately 96-percent field of view and an approximately 0.85-times magnification.

Versatile Auto Picture mode

The PENTAX-developed Auto Picture mode automatically sets the most appropriate shooting mode (such as Portrait, Landscape and Macro) for a given subject or situation. The K200D not only sets an aperture and a shutter speed, but also adjusts white-balance, saturation, contrast and sharpness levels, allowing the photographer to concentrate on image composition and shutter opportunity.

Large 2.7-inch wide-view LCD monitor

The large 2.7-inch colour LCD monitor allows you to zoom in on the image up to 20X. The LCD’s wide-view design allows the photographer to check the monitor image from approximately 160 degrees both vertically and horizontally.

    "Like Sony does in the A200 and Olympus does in the E420, Pentax includes wireless flash control in the K200D. Nikon reserves that feature for its D80 and pricier models, while Canon forces you to buy its 580EX flash or the dedicated wireless controller if you want wireless flash control. Granted, the Canon system offers a higher level of control than the Sony, Olympus, or Pentax entry-level versions, but it's nice to have some wireless flash functionality at the entry-level. The K200D lets you use the built-in flash to trigger either the AF540FGZ or AF360FGZ flash units. You can't group flashes or set ratios between flashes, but you can control the flash output with the camera's flash-compensation setting, which is conveniently changed in the flash setting part of the Fn menu. Also, you can set the camera to use the built-in flash along with one or multiple wireless flashes, or you can set the built-in flash to just control the wireless flashes and not fire when the picture is taken. In case you're wondering, the wireless flash works with Pentax's P-TTL flash metering.
